Born: 3 August 1687 in Eastham, Massachusetts, Dominion of New England

Father: John FREEMAN
Mother: Sarah MERRICK
Paternal grandparents: John FREEMAN , Mercy PRENCE
Maternal grandparents: William MERRICK , Rebecca TRACY


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Mercy  married  Chillingsworth FOSTER 14 February 1705 in Barnstable, Province of Massachusetts Bay .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Chillingsworth FOSTER  was born 11 July 1680 in Marshfield, Massachusetts, USA (Rexhame) (East Marshfield) (Green Harbor) (Ocean Bluff) (Marshfield Hills) (Brant Rock).  Chillingsworth died 22 December 1764 in Barnstable, Massachusetts, USA (Cotuit) (Centerville) (Hyannis).  Chillingsworth was the child of John FOSTER and Mary CHILLINGSWORTH.

Mercy FREEMAN died 7 July 1720 in Harwich, Province of Massachusetts Bay .

Did You Know?The name 'Massachusetts' originates with native Americans in the Massachusetts Bay area (from the language of the Algonquian nation). The name translates roughly as 'at or about the great hill.' (statesymbolsusa.org)

1620 - 1627 - Plymouth Colony, New England
1628 - 1686 - Massachusetts Bay Colony
1686 - 1689 - Dominion of New England
1689 - 1692 - Massachusetts Bay Colony
1692 - 1775 - Province of Massachusetts Bay
1776 - 1788 - Crown Colony of Massachusetts Bay
February 6, 1788 - Massachusetts becomes 6th U.S. state
